First Introduction in Nishi-Shinjuku: Next-Generation Lifting Device "Cellinew"
We have introduced "Cellinew," the latest lifting device attracting attention in Korea. Its unique auto-fit system allows for optimal energy delivery tailored to the skin condition. The combination of high-speed irradiation and cooling function reduces pain and burden during treatment. This treatment is ideal for those seeking to improve firmness and sagging with minimal downtime.
・Price: From 59,400 yen for 200 shots (This treatment is self-pay).
・Main risks and side effects: Temporary redness, warmth, or dryness may occur, but in most cases, the procedure does not significantly interfere with daily life. The course of recovery varies depending on skin type and physical condition.
・Cellinew is an unapproved medical device in Japan.
・Acquisition route: The Cellinew used at our clinic is acquired under the responsibility of our clinic's physician.
・Availability of approved domestic pharmaceuticals, etc.: There are no approved medical devices with the same performance in Japan.
・Information on safety in other countries: Cellinew is approved by the FDA in the United States and KFDA (MFDS) in Korea.
・About the Pharmaceutical Side Effect Relief System: This treatment is not covered by public relief systems.

Director's Profile
Director: Lin Chia-Hsun (Lin Jashun), originally from Taiwan.
After graduating from National Taiwan University School of Medicine and working at its affiliated hospital, he came to Japan.
He honed his skills as a dermatologist at the University of Tokyo Hospital and Tokyo Jikei University Hospital. Based on his belief that "aging cannot be stopped, but its progression can be slowed," he proposes medical care that maintains beauty from multiple perspectives.
